HMZ-T2 Rumors

This morning, two European tech news sites, Eurogamer.net and Computerandvideogames.com, published stories detailing a virtual 3D headset that Sony is planning to release alongside their hotly anticipated Playstation 4.  The CVG article states that the plan was to reveal this device at Gamescom, but plans fell through at the last minute.  The Eurogamer article draws comparisons between the rumored device and a device that Sony has already put out, the HMZ-T2, as well as drawing comparisons to the Oculus Rift.
I didn't believe this story when I initially read it.  In the months and years before the Playstation 4 and Xbox One were revealed, there were many different rumors going around about what those consoles were going to be, what accessories they were going to have, and what grand and spectacular things those devices were going to be able to do.  Most of those rumors turned out to be false.  Some of those rumors turned out to be laughably false.  Since the articles referenced above referenced a virtual 3D headset, I thought this would turn out to be one of those rumors that would be laughably false.  However, as I dug around, the story started to become more real to me.
Most of the rumors about the Playstation 4 and the Xbox One that turned out to be laughably false sites as sources posts on Reddit, Neogaff, or other sites where rumors spread like wildfire.  People now believe that the laughably false rumors were either plants made by Microsoft or Sony to see where leaks were coming from, or an elaborate joke by some internet prankster.  The stories posted this morning reference none of these sources.  The CVG article sites several sources who wish to remain anonymous, as well as an interview they did with Sony Worldwide Studios boss Shuhei Yoshida.  The Eurogamer article sites multiple sources, as well as detailing a demonstration involving Evolution Studios' upcoming title DriveClub, a studio which they note has been involved in 3D development before.
There's also the question of the headset.  The Eurogamer article references a device called the HMZ-T2, the name of which brings up memories of the action-blockbuster Terminator 2.  The thing is, the HMZ-T2 is real.  Not only that, Engadget is reporting about a third iteration of this product, set to be unveiled at a Sony event to be held tomorrow.  Leaks the day before a product unveiling are not uncommon, as it is significantly harder to keep news from coming out about a product that it was in the 80's and 90's.
So this may turn out to be real.  Sony may be putting out a virtual 3D headset alongside their hotly anticipated Playstation 4... or they may be coming out with a new product that will not be successful.  Remember, the HMZ-T2 has not been much of a success, and the new iteration of this product may not be so much a Playstation 4 accessory, but an accessory that can hook into most modern video playing devices, including the Playstation 4.  If the rumors are true, we may see tomorrow what this product actually is.  Is it the wave of the future that some think that it is, or is it the thing that will slowly collect dust on the shelf of that rich guy you know who blows all his money on the latest tech?  Well will soon see.
